Analysis
In 2024, green garlic — gross production value in Algeria stood at 629,721 1000 USD. That is the highest value across all 51 years on record.
The figure is up 8.9% on the previous year and up 157.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, green garlic — gross production value in Algeria peaked at 629,721 1000 USD in 2024 and was at its lowest, 2,653 1000 USD, in 1974.
That places Algeria 5th out of 77 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top 10%.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
